How much do hr generalist j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average yearly pay for hr generalist in Raleigh, NC is $58,130.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$45,900.00 and $65,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an HR generalist do?

A human resources (HR) generalist plays a vital role in the performance and success of a business. As an HR generalist, you will oversee the human resources department policies and procedures. You will manage hiring and layoff procedures, strategize performance incentives, oversee employee wellbeing, and manage employee communications. This is truly an essential role for any mid-sized to large business.

What is an HR generalist?

HR Generalists are human resources professionals who handle a wide variety of HR tasks within an organization. Their responsibilities typically include recruitment, employee relations, benefits administration, performance management, and ensuring compliance with labor laws. HR Generalists serve as a key point of contact for employees and management on HR-related matters and help support a positive workplace culture. They often work in small to mid-sized companies, but their skills are valuable in organizations of all sizes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an HR generalist, and why are they important?

To excel as an HR Generalist, you need a solid understanding of HR principles, employment law, recruitment, and benefits administration, typically supported by a bachelor’s degree in human resources or a related field. Familiarity with HRIS (Human Resources Information Systems), payroll software, and certifications like SHRM-CP or PHR are commonly required. Strong interpersonal skills,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ication set top candidates apart. These competencies are essential for ensuring compliance, managing employee relations, and supporting organizational success.

What is the difference between Hr Generalist vs HR Coordinator?

AspectHR GeneralistHR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esHandles a wide range of HR functions including recruitment, employee relations, benefits, and complianceSupports HR functions, focusing on administrative tasks like scheduling interviews, maintaining records, and onboarding
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in HR, Business, or related field; HR certifications preferredBachelor's degree often preferred; HR or administrative certifications beneficial
Work EnvironmentTypically in HR departments across various industries, interacting with employees and managementOften in HR or administrative offices, supporting HR teams

The main difference between an HR Generalist and an HR Coordinator lies in scope and responsibilities. HR Generalists handle comprehensive HR functions, while HR Coordinators focus on administrative support tasks.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ds, but HR Generalists usually have broader experience and responsibilities.
